This compact, heavily-illustrated guide makes it a snap to identify period styles from the 17th century to the present day. The Guide to Period Styles for Interiors, Second Edition is a comprehensive reference that combines depth of content with ease of use. Including examples and analysis on 17th-century Louis XIV through 20th-century Late Modern and each style in between, this new edition is also updated with the latest trends of the 21st century, including computer design, sustainable design, and modern office design. New sidebars interspersed throughout the book offer glimpses into historic design styles from around the globe. Each style section ends with a summary of key characteristics, major designers, and iconic fabrics. This book is an indispensable tool for identifying the trends throughout the history of interior design.



About the Author

Judith Gura

Judith Gura has been teaching and writing about interior design and furnishings for more than a decade, with a special focus on the 20th (and now the 21st) centuries. Her books combine a lively and accessible writing style with an in-depth knowledge of the marketplace and the museum world as well as academia. She currently heads the design history department at the New York School of Interior Design, and writes regularly for national publications in the art and design field.
